117.info
人生若只如初见

ubuntu系统防火墙能否自定义策略

Ubuntu系统确实支持自定义防火墙策略,主要通过UFW(Uncomplicated Firewall)和iptables两种工具来实现。这两种工具都提供了丰富的选项,允许用户根据自己的需求设置防火墙规则。

UFW(Uncomplicated Firewall)

UFW是Ubuntu系统默认的防火墙管理工具,它提供了一个简单易用的界面来管理防火墙规则。通过UFW,用户可以:

  • 允许拒绝特定的端口或服务。
  • 自定义规则以允许或拒绝来自特定IP地址的流量。
  • 查看防火墙状态和已配置的规则。

例如,要允许SSH连接(默认端口22),可以使用命令:sudo ufw allow 22

iptables

iptables是Linux系统中的一个更底层的防火墙管理工具,它提供了更高级的功能,允许用户定义更复杂的规则。通过iptables,用户可以:

  • 允许拒绝特定的端口或服务。
  • 基于IP地址、子网或端口范围设置规则。
  • 删除或添加规则,以及保存规则集。

例如,要允许HTTP(端口80)流量,可以使用命令:s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T

自定义策略的步骤

  1. 安装UFW(如果尚未安装):sudo apt install ufw
  2. 启用UFWsudo ufw enable
  3. 允许特定服务sudo ufw allow [服务名称或端口]
  4. 拒绝特定服务sudo ufw deny [服务名称或端口]
  5. 查看防火墙状态sudo ufw status

通过上述步骤,用户可以轻松地在Ubuntu系统上自定义防火墙策略,以保护系统安全并满足特定的网络需求。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ef3bAzsNAwRWBA.html

推荐文章

  • 如何在Ubuntu更新Postman

    在Ubuntu系统上更新Postman有多种方法,以下是其中两种常用的方法:
    通过Snap包管理器更新Postman 打开终端(可以通过按下 Ctrl + Alt + T 快捷键来打开)。...

  • 配置Ubuntu FTP服务器需要哪些准备

    配置Ubuntu FTP服务器需要以下准备:
    1. 更新系统
    确保你的Ubuntu系统是最新的。在终端中运行以下命令来更新系统:
    sudo apt update
    sudo a...

  • Ubuntu Aliases在远程操作中的应用

    在Ubuntu系统中,Aliases(别名)通常用于简化命令行操作,提高工作效率。虽然Aliases本身不直接应用于远程操作,但它们可以与SSH配置结合使用,从而在远程访问U...

  • Ubuntu ifconfig中如何查看DNS服务器

    在 Ubuntu 中,您可以通过以下几种方法查看 DNS 服务器的配置:
    方法一:使用 cat 命令查看 /etc/resolv.conf 打开终端。
    输入以下命令并按回车键:ca...

  • linux系统和ubuntu哪个更便于维护

    Linux系统和Ubuntu都是基于Linux内核的操作系统,但它们在维护方面有一些区别。以下是对这两个系统的比较:
    维护的便利性 Linux系统:Linux是一个广泛的术语...

  • ubuntu单点登录有无安全隐患

    Ubuntu单点登录(SSO)本身并不直接存在安全隐患,但如果配置不当或与其他安全漏洞结合,可能会增加安全风险。以下是关于Ubuntu单点登录的相关信息:
    Ubunt...

  • ubuntu和Linux哪个更利于性能发挥

    Ubuntu是Linux的一个发行版,因此,将Ubuntu和Linux进行比较并不恰当。实际上,Ubuntu在许多方面都被认为是性能较好的Linux发行版之一。以下是对Ubuntu性能特点的...

  • php array_merge_deep能否合并同名键

    array_merge_deep() 函数用于合并两个或多个多维数组。当遇到同名键时,它会将这些键的值合并为一个新的数组,而不是覆盖它们。
    例如,假设有两个数组: